Significance
The first breath of spring, dedicated to Saraswati — goddess of learning, music, speech, and the arts. Yellow, the colour of ripening mustard fields, is worn everywhere.
The story behind Vasant Panchami
Vasant Panchami welcomes the season of Vasant (spring) and honours the goddess who embodies knowledge and creativity. It is considered so auspicious that it needs no further muhurta — a day for beginnings of every kind, from a child's first letters to the first note of a raga.
How Vasant Panchami is observed
- Placing books, instruments, and tools before Saraswati for her blessing.
- Wearing yellow and offering yellow flowers and sweets.
- Vidyarambham — starting young children on reading and writing.
- An auspicious day for weddings, housewarmings, and new ventures.
